Operations Support Manager
Develop and manage strategic long-term mechanical integrity programs/projects and address short-term operational issues. Responsible for the effective implementation of maintenance and repair programs, equipment safety programs, and equipment/machinery utilization to achieve minimum downtime with maximum productivity. Oversee and direct maintenance activities (corrective, preventive, and predictive), Planning/Scheduling (work order management), and Material Control (supply chain management) for the region. Build collaborative relationships among the varying levels of the organization from industrial mechanics to management for asset care . Provide leadership in meeting Mechanical Integrity and Quality Assurance (MIQA) requirements/standards to prevent Process Safety Incidents at sites due to MIQA deficiencies. Responsible for ensuring construction and maintenance activities adhere to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) standards. Manage regional budgets for fixed, capital, and variable spending related to mechanical integrity and construction activities. Administer personnel actions; train and develop subordinate personnel.
Mechanical Integrity-Quality Assurance Team Lead
Lead and manage a multifaceted team consisting of engineers, foremen, planning coordinators, technicians, and clerks who provide operations support to the company’s facilities, completions, and production activities in the Eagle Ford. Responsible for developing the preventive and predictive maintenance program for wellheads, separator skids, tank batteries, and pipeline gathering systems. Responsible for establishing standard operating procedures for processing and tracking oilfield service provider work orders, providing quality assurance/quality control by maintaining audit trails through work histories and inspections. Responsible for implementing scheduled maintenance of all production equipment on well pads. Responsible for developing and implementing inventory control and asset care procedures with associated tracking and reporting protocols, establishing cost controls and supply discipline. Responsible for reducing the company’s reliance on outsourcing maintenance by identifying areas where cost savings opportunities exist, then develop standard work plans and procedures to meet maintenance requirements.
